Transaction 20466717e0ecae0eef7b635e685df6d790ed0b718d0dc31069d4322252584a90
1 Input
1 Output
-
20466717e0ecae0eef7b635e685df6d790ed0b718d0dc31069d4322252584a90:0
- value
- 28528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 662a649abe778dd0a993833217731cc597ab55c1 OP_EQUAL
- address
- 3B1DddJjHt4V49x8RdEcfJajHn3QoW67eT